| Description | Lagerstroemia indica x fauriei
Natchez Crepe Myrtle is a deciduous tree creates great interest throughout the year. In summer, clusters of spectacular white, crepe-paper like flowers are produced. Following this, the dark green leaves add further interest as they transition into autumn, turning a rich bronzy red colour before falling. Bark also provides colour as the tree matures, with it’s flakiness revealing the rich, brown underbark. A beautiful growth habit and resistant to mildew, this variety will tolerate periods of dryness once established.

| Camellia sasanqua
Paradise Blush is a hardy, compact, evergreen shrub that reaches up to 4m tall. It bears beautiful pink buds that open into white flowers with a pink blush in Autumn and Winter.
Paradise Blush Camellias are hybrid camellias bred in Australia to suit conditions here. They're perfect for hedging and will also look great as a feature in a large container or pot. Plant in a sunny position in rich, well drained soil. Water well and mulch in hotter months. Prune lightly and fertilise in Spring. | Gaura lindheimeri "Butterfly Bush"
Butterfly Bush is a bushy, hardy perennial shrub with long graceful stems that bloom with pale pink flowers in spring-summer. These stems grow up to 1m long, but can be clipped back shorter, and sway gracefully in the breeze. The name of a popular variety, Whirling Butterflies, perfectly describes the way the plant resembles a cloud of butterflies when swaying in the breeze.
